A Gold IRA vs. 401(k) Showdown for Savvy Retirees
Planning for retirement can feel overwhelming, especially when you're faced with various investment options. Two popular choices that often come up are the traditional Gold IRA and the 401(k). While both offer tax advantages for retirement savings, they have unique characteristics that may make one a better fit for your personal needs. Here's delve into the key differences between these two retirement vehicles.
- Initially, consider your risk tolerance. A Gold IRA invests in physical gold, which is often seen as a stable asset during economic instability. A 401(k), on the other hand, typically allocates to a mix of stocks, bonds, and other assets, which can offer more significant upside.
- Furthermore, examine your retirement objectives. If you're aiming for long-term growth, a 401(k) with its broader investment options might be more appropriate. However, if you prioritize maintaining value during uncertain times, a Gold IRA could offer more peace of mind.
- Lastly, compare the fees and expenses each choice. Particular 401(k) plans may have greater expense ratios than Gold IRAs.
Keep in mind that this is a general overview and your individual situation should guide your decision. It's always advisable to consult with a qualified financial advisor before making any substantial changes to your portfolio.
Secure Your Financial Future with a Gold IRA
Considering potential rewards of a gold IRA? These accounts offer a unique way to invest in precious metals, potentially shielding your assets from economic uncertainty. However, it's crucial to consider both advantages and disadvantages before taking the plunge.
- A Gold IRA offers potential diversification benefits, helping to mitigate risk by allocating a portion of your investments to a tangible asset that oftenholds value during economic downturns.Gold is a finite resource, potentially providing long-term value as global demand continues to rise.
- A Gold IRA can be illiquid compared to traditional IRAs, meaning it may take some time to convert your assets into cash.The costs associated with setting up and maintaining a Gold IRA, including storage fees and annual maintenance charges, canbecome significant over time. Gold prices can fluctuate widely, influencing the value of your investment.
Ultimately, the decision of whether or not a Gold IRA is right for you depends on your individualinvestment objectives. It's essential to consult with a qualified financial advisor to carefully evaluate the implications and potential risks involved.
